Output 259975a11dd56e8e7cd2d39c91fe1ddd4ca461fe897725b8b68031906c2a6f85:1

value
6954226792299
script pubkey
OP_0 OP_PUSHBYTES_20 50b5e24be006254c0f53ec2f49655739295300c1
address
tb1q2z67yjlqqcj5cr6nash5je2h8y54xqxph75e28
transaction
259975a11dd56e8e7cd2d39c91fe1ddd4ca461fe897725b8b68031906c2a6f85
confirmations
185917
spent
true